Quantum Computing: Masa Depan Pemrograman Super Cepat

Komputasi modern telah menjadi tulang punggung hampir semua aspek kehidupan, dari komunikasi, keuangan, hingga kecerdasan buatan (AI). Namun, komputer klasik memiliki keterbatasan ketika dihadapkan pada masalah kompleks berskala besar, seperti simulasi molekul obat atau pemecahan enkripsi tingkat tinggi.
Di sinilah quantum computing muncul sebagai paradigma baru. Dengan memanfaatkan prinsip mekanika kuantum, teknologi ini menjanjikan kecepatan pemrosesan eksponensial dan potensi merevolusi cara manusia menggunakan komputer.
Apa Itu Quantum Computing?
Quantum computing adalah model komputasi yang menggunakan qubit sebagai unit dasar data. Tidak seperti bit pada komputer klasik (0 atau 1), qubit dapat berada dalam kondisi superposition (0 dan 1 sekaligus) serta entanglement (terhubung dengan qubit lain).
Kombinasi kedua sifat ini memungkinkan komputer kuantum menyelesaikan jutaan kemungkinan secara paralel, yang mustahil dilakukan oleh komputer tradisional.
Mengapa Quantum Computing Disebut “Super Cepat”?
-
Superposition → Qubit dapat menyimpan lebih banyak informasi daripada bit biasa.
-
Entanglement → Qubit yang saling terhubung bisa memproses data bersama, meskipun terpisah secara fisik.
-
Interferensi → Algoritma kuantum dapat menghilangkan jawaban salah dan memperkuat jawaban benar, mempercepat hasil perhitungan.
Aplikasi Nyata Quantum Computing
-
Kriptografi
-
Algoritma Shor mampu memecahkan enkripsi RSA yang selama ini dianggap aman.
-
Muncul kebutuhan baru: post-quantum cryptography.
-
-
Kecerdasan Buatan & Machine Learning
-
Quantum machine learning bisa melatih model AI dengan data lebih besar dan lebih cepat.
-
-
Industri Farmasi & Kesehatan
-
Simulasi molekul obat yang kompleks untuk menemukan kandidat obat baru.
-
-
Energi & Material
-
Menemukan material baru untuk baterai, panel surya, atau superkonduktor.
-
-
Keuangan & Logistik
-
Optimasi portofolio investasi.
-
Menentukan jalur transportasi terbaik dengan variabel kompleks.
-
Tantangan Besar Quantum Computing
-
Decoherence & Noise → Qubit sangat rapuh terhadap lingkungan, membuat hasil perhitungan bisa salah.
-
Kebutuhan Suhu Ekstrem → Banyak komputer kuantum saat ini hanya bisa beroperasi pada suhu mendekati nol absolut.
-
Biaya Produksi → Infrastruktur masih sangat mahal.
-
Kurangnya Developer Ahli → Hanya segelintir programmer yang menguasai pemrograman kuantum.
Bahasa Pemrograman & Tools Quantum Computing
Walau masih baru, beberapa platform sudah dikembangkan:
-
Qiskit (Python, IBM) → framework open source untuk membuat algoritma kuantum.
-
Cirq (Google) → library Python untuk eksperimen quantum computing.
-
Q# (Microsoft) → bahasa khusus untuk pemrograman kuantum.
-
Ocean SDK (D-Wave) → fokus pada optimasi kuantum.
Para developer bisa mengakses komputer kuantum melalui Quantum Cloud Computing tanpa harus membeli perangkat keras sendiri.
Tren Terbaru Quantum Computing
-
Quantum Cloud → IBM, Google, dan Microsoft sudah membuka layanan akses kuantum berbasis cloud.
-
Hybrid Quantum-Classical Computing → Kolaborasi komputer klasik dan kuantum untuk hasil lebih efisien.
-
Post-Quantum Security → Dunia sedang bersiap dengan algoritma enkripsi tahan-kuantum.
-
Quantum AI → Integrasi quantum computing dengan kecerdasan buatan generatif.
-
Komersialisasi Bertahap → Dari laboratorium menuju industri, diperkirakan 10–20 tahun mendatang.
Dampak Quantum Computing bagi Developer
-
Skill Baru Dibutuhkan → Developer perlu belajar algoritma kuantum dan framework seperti Qiskit atau Q#.
-
Pergeseran Paradigma → Dari pemrograman deterministik menuju probabilistik.
-
Peluang Karir Besar → Permintaan untuk ahli pemrograman kuantum akan melonjak di bidang AI, keamanan, dan riset.
Kesimpulan
Quantum computing bukan sekadar evolusi teknologi, tetapi revolusi komputasi. Dengan kecepatan pemrosesan yang luar biasa, ia berpotensi mengubah industri farmasi, keuangan, kecerdasan buatan, hingga keamanan siber.
Meski tantangannya besar, arah pengembangannya sudah jelas. Dalam beberapa dekade ke depan, quantum computing akan menjadi fondasi utama pemrograman super cepat, membuka peluang baru yang bahkan sulit kita bayangkan hari ini.
What's Your Reaction?






